Christian Tessmer has an auction sale on Thursday, February 26, at 1 o'clock, on the David Fitzsimmons farm four miles out of the city on the Pontiac road. He will sell a span of matched greys, four and five years old, two colts, three steers, four cows, binder, mower, wagons, harness, reaper, cultivator, rakes, chickens, etc. Fred Krause, auctioneer. Patrick Gibney sells at auction on Monday, March 2, at 10 o'clock, on bis farm in Northfield, on the East Whitmore lake road, six miles north of Ann Arbor and one-half mile west of the Center, two span horses, one bfeèdifig mafê, 60 fine wool sheep, six cows, Durham buil, five calves, 800 head cabbage, harvester binder, cutting box, Little Giant cultivator, spring tooth harrow, hay rack, wagons, buggies and many other farming utensils. Christian Braun sells at auction on Tuesday, March 3, at one o'clock, nine miles out on the Pontiac road and one mile south of Pebbles' church, four colts, three, two and one years old, two new milch cows, two yearling steers and ninety choice young sheep.
